Hammam likes to draw his old home, longing for his country that was destroyed because of war and preserving his good memories. This story takes on the difficult issues of war and how children cope with such painful situations. This story sheds a light on how beneficial a child’s imagination can be to deal with those situations and help survivors to maintain hope as they look forward to a better future despite the struggles they endure.
